THE VOLUNTEERS.

NONCOMMISSIONED OFFICERS' CLUB. The annuat meeting of the Non-Commis-sioued Officers' Club was held last night, when there was an attendance of eighteen members. Sergeant-Major Barrett presided. The balance sheet showing the receipts to be £9 19s 9d, and the expenditure £6 12s, w*as adopted. On the motion of Colour-Sergeant Bean it was decided to write off all outstanding subscriptions for the six months up to and including February last. This course was taken largely owing to the faot that the Club has been practically dormant for some six months past. Officers for the ensuing year were elected as under:—Patron, Lieutenant-Colonel Gordon; president, Sergeant-Major Barrett; vicepresident, Sergeant-Major Foster; secretary, Colour-Sergeant Steere ; treasurer, Sergeant Mathias; auditor, Corporal Woodfield. Colour-Sergeant Bean gave notice of motion —" That five members form tho committee, three of whom shall form a quorum." It was decided to hold a special meeting on next Wednesday night for the purpose of considering this proposal. Sergeant-Major Foster gave notice of motion —" That the night of the regular meeting be changed." It was decided to hold the annual social at a date to be fixed, after the Easter encampment.

A team of twelve men of the N Battery, under the command of Corporal Taylor, went South by the express yesterday morning to Port Chalmers to hold a shooting competition with the Port Chalmers Navals.

The annual meeting of the College Rifles will be held in their orderly room at 8 p.m. to-night.
